Abstract
Neutralization procedure for organic sulfur compounds and apparatus for carrying it out, the method of which is characterized by a method of sulfation or sulfonation of a liquid organic compound, in which it receives the form of a liquid film on a supporting and confining thermal exchange surface defining a reaction zone, and a pressurized mixture of inert gas and gaseous sulfur trioxide is incised in said reaction zone against said liquid film at a speed effective to induce mixed turbulence in said film, and characterized by that the neutralization of the liquid product from said reaction zone is carried out by mixing with an alkali metal salt within a time of approximately 1 minute after the exit from said zone.
